'

Captain Marvel

' co-director Ryan Fleck has confirmed that the shooting of the Brie Larson-fronted film is complete. Fleck, who is helming the superhero movie with directing-writing partner Anna Boden, teased the news on Instagram.

    He posted a picture of a shooting schedule, with the page stating "Day 75 of 75", which suggests that the film has just finished-up production.

    Fleck captioned the photo: "We got next..."


    Brie Larson also took to social media to share a picture of a 'Captain Marvel' clapperboard and a calendar with the days of shooting all crossed out.

    'Captain Marvel', which is set to release on March 8, 2019, is a first

    Marvel Studios

    project to be fronted by a female superhero. Larson portrays the character of

    Carol Danvers

    / Captain Marvel, a US Air Force pilot whose DNA is fused with that of an alien during an accident, which imbues her with the powers of superhuman strength, energy projection, and flight.

    The film also features Samuel L Jackson, Ben Mendelsohn, Djimon Hounsou, Lee Pace, Lashana Lynch, Gemma Chan, Algenis Perez Soto and Jude Law, among others.
